Here is a list of tuition-free universities for Nigerian students:
- University of the People (UoPeople): UoPeople is an online, tuition-free university that offers various undergraduate and graduate degree programs.
- Freie Universität Berlin: This German university offers tuition-free education for both domestic and international students, including Nigerian students. However, there may be some administrative fees and living expenses.
- University of Oslo: The University of Oslo in Norway offers tuition-free education, including for international students. However, there may be some semester fees and living expenses.
- Ludwig Maximilian University of Munich: This German university offers tuition-free education for both domestic and international students, including Nigerian students. However, there may be some administrative fees and living expenses.
- Technical University of Munich: The Technical University of Munich in Germany offers tuition-free education for both domestic and international students, including Nigerian students. However, there may be some administrative fees and living expenses.
- Aarhus University: Aarhus University in Denmark offers tuition-free education for students from the European Union (EU) and the European Economic Area (EEA), including Nigerian students. However, non-EU/EEA students may have to pay tuition fees.
- Lund University: Lund University in Sweden offers tuition-free education for students from the EU/EEA and Switzerland. However, non-EU/EEA students may have to pay tuition fees.
Note: It’s important to note that while these universities offer tuition-free education, there may still be additional costs such as living expenses, accommodation, and other fees. Additionally, admission requirements and application processes may vary for each institution, so it’s advisable to visit their official websites for detailed information and updates.
FAQs
What are the tuition-free universities available to Nigerian students?
Some universities offer tuition-free education through scholarships, government funding, or special programs. Notable examples include the University of the People (online, fully tuition-free), certain programs in European countries such as Germany and Norway, and select African institutions offering full scholarships to international students, including Nigerians.
How can Nigerian students apply to tuition-free universities?
Application procedures vary depending on the university. For online institutions like the University of the People, students apply directly through the school’s website. For European universities, students usually apply through national portals or the university’s admission office, providing academic transcripts, proof of language proficiency, and sometimes motivation letters.
Are there hidden fees at tuition-free universities?
Even at tuition-free universities, students may be responsible for administrative fees, exam fees, or living expenses. For example, the University of the People charges minimal assessment fees per course, and European tuition-free universities often require students to cover housing, food, and other personal costs.
Do tuition-free universities offer degrees recognized internationally?
Yes, most reputable tuition-free universities provide accredited degrees that are internationally recognized. It is important for students to verify accreditation and program recognition before applying, especially for professional courses such as medicine, engineering, or law.
